I am an artist and an art educator trained at Pratt Institute,Hofstra University, Hunter College, and New York University with many years of teaching in a variety of media on the elementary, high school and college levels. I was director of visual art and arts-in-education at Henry Street Settlement where I developed initiatives, supervised teaching artists in the visual and performing arts ,and oversaw an exhibition program, an instruction program, an artist in residence program ,and a summer arts day camp. I worked with public schools in integrated arts and learning programs and provided arts experiences for adult Settlement participants in the senior, mental health, and womens’ shelter programs and participated in many art education retreats, conferences and workshops within the art education field regarding evaluation, development, planning, partnering, and other issues important to the arts and the wider educational community. Since Henry Street, I have been working in both artists books and collage and exhibiting regularly in galleries, art centers, and museums. For the past five years, I have been teaching collage/mixed media to adults and seniors concentrating on developing mastery, and personal expression. I am also on the board of directors of Elders Share the Arts as the teaching artists representative.

I greatly enjoy teaching older adults over the past five years and view it as a real integration of my own art practice in collage with my educational training ,and experiences at Henry Street Settlement, a community organization. It has been inspiring to see the power of the arts to transform lives of people who previously had little or no access to creative endeavors. I would also like to work with teaching artists and senior center staff in a professional development and mentoring capacity to help the delivery of programs for older adults.
